**Ticket: Driver-assignment heuristic favors idle vans too hard**

Hey — welcome aboard! The Pellway dispatcher keeps sending far-away idle vans instead of nearby busy ones finishing a drop. Suspect the idle-time weight in `assign_score` got doubled last sprint. Repro on staging with the Brockton Hills fixture. The offending build's token is pasted below.

trace token, fafog-kageg: htk4_98e6

# Reviewer notes: this env config enables the new three-way merge for events
# edited simultaneously on device and server. CONFLICT_STRATEGY=merge keeps
# both edits and flags the event; 'server-wins' is the legacy fallback.
# SYNC_WINDOW_DAYS controls how far back we reconcile; anything above 90
# caused timeouts in load tests, so please flag if you see it raised.
# Token exchange with the upstream calendar provider requires a client
# secret, which is set on the next line.

vault entry, yahif-yajep: COURIER_KEY29=b802bdf8034096b65a51c6ba5abe2

Subject: Cron → Orchestrator handover

Hi Varek,

Quick notes before I'm out. All nightly crons on dresk-db02 are moving into Trellisflow. Backfill jobs are done; only the vacuum and stats jobs remain. Definitions live in the orchestrator repo under /jobs. Disable each cron only after its first green run. The staging database is reachable via the connection string below.

primary connection of yagep-kahip = redis://giliel_svc:zYiKsLL2PLpfPL@db-348f.xolmarsys.corp:5432/fenwyn

Studio B on level 2 is reserved for recording training videos for the Larkspur Academy series. Reception confirms bookings in the Hallvue calendar, hands presenters the lapel mic kit, and logs equipment returns. No walk-ins during red-light sessions. The studio door stays locked at all times; use the pass below to open it.

staff pass of kawip-hawef = bdg-QLP-2

Quick note for Thursday's sync: the Larkbottle static-analysis baseline file (baseline.yml) is now the source of truth for suppressed findings. Don't hand-edit it — regenerate with the scrubber script or the diff gets noisy and Priya will haunt you. New findings above the baseline block merges, which is the whole point. To push an updated baseline to the Wrenhollow artifact store, sign it with the key shown below.

rollout seal: bky4_x7Gc